As I Was A-Walking is a one-day-only performance walk that revels in the past, present and future of the Oxfordshire countryside in the stunning surroundings of Honeydale Farm – home of the award-winning, not-for-profit organisation, FarmED.

Explore the fields, hedgerows and barns enjoying live renditions of local folk songs, stories and poetry as you go. Experience readings and performances including works by Michael Morpurgo, try traditional straw crafts, and enjoy haunting pastoral songs and traditional folk tunes.

How It Works:

Book your slot, and on the day join with others to follow the route map provided. Walks depart at 20 minute intervals between 11am and 6pm, and last around 75 minutes.

Locally sourced food and drinks will be available to buy throughout the day in FarmED’s acclaimed organic café.
